From what I understand, it's thinking the reverse of tags.  When you're
in a folder with Gmail, what you're actually seeing is all the emails
that are labelled with that label.  The only real folders seem to be
"[Gmail]/All Mail" and "[Gmail]/Trash".

So, onto my point, when you "delete" an email, you're actually only
removing a label; when you "move" an email, you're removing a label and
adding another; and when you're "saving" or "copying", you're adding a
label.
